Transaction 097f1791c724d369c83e5bb2d6047ee63160c4b985e70a128bd532e0a99a672b
1 Input
2 Outputs
- 097f1791c724d369c83e5bb2d6047ee63160c4b985e70a128bd532e0a99a672b:0
- 097f1791c724d369c83e5bb2d6047ee63160c4b985e70a128bd532e0a99a672b:1
value 28410
address 3Kieg7LUcXFRAsY7AACAuc7L5uWrzHGfH5
value 1018281
address 1sA2PTcEGRvH5bbDEh3hJDu3dnLjwkq1s